The Library Automation Service System market is poised for significant expansion, with an estimated market size of $13.77 billion by 2025. The market is projected to grow at a robust Compound Annual Growth Rate (CAGR) of 11.05% from 2025 to 2033. This upward trajectory is propelled by the increasing demand for efficient library management solutions across academic and public institutions. The proliferation of digital resources necessitates integrated systems for seamless management of both physical and digital collections, a key driver of market growth. Enhanced user experience through advanced technologies like self-service kiosks and mobile applications further fuels market expansion. The market is segmented by system type into Commercial and Open Source, with Commercial systems currently leading due to their advanced features and comprehensive support. Key market players include Clarivate (Ex Libris, Innovative Interfaces), SirsiDynix, and OCLC, who are actively engaged in innovation, strategic partnerships, and acquisitions. Geographically, North America and Europe exhibit strong market presence, while Asia-Pacific presents substantial growth opportunities driven by rising literacy and government investments in library infrastructure.


Market growth is moderated by the substantial initial investment required for library automation systems, particularly challenging for smaller institutions. Integration complexities and the need for specialized staff training also pose adoption hurdles. However, the long-term advantages of enhanced efficiency, superior resource management, and improved user satisfaction justify these investments. The growing availability of cost-effective and scalable cloud-based solutions is expanding market reach, especially in developing economies. Open-source systems are also gaining traction as budget-friendly alternatives. Future growth hinges on technological advancements, including AI-powered search and recommendation engines, enhanced accessibility features, and improved system interoperability.

Several factors are propelling the growth of the library automation service system market. The increasing volume of digital resources necessitates efficient management systems capable of handling vast amounts of data and providing easy access to users. This has led to a surge in demand for sophisticated ILS, capable of indexing, cataloging, and managing digital assets effectively. The need for enhanced user experience is another crucial driver. Modern library patrons expect intuitive interfaces, streamlined search functionalities, and personalized services, prompting libraries to adopt systems that cater to these expectations. Cloud-based solutions are becoming increasingly popular due to their cost-effectiveness, scalability, and accessibility. These systems offer libraries the flexibility to adapt to changing needs without significant upfront investments. Furthermore, the rising adoption of mobile technology and the increasing popularity of mobile library applications are contributing to this growth. Libraries are integrating mobile apps into their operations, thereby providing seamless access to their resources. The integration of advanced technologies like AI and ML is further enhancing the efficiency of library operations. AI-powered systems can automate tasks such as cataloging, improve search algorithms, and provide personalized recommendations to users. These factors combined represent a powerful force driving significant growth within the Library Automation Service System sector.
Despite the significant growth potential, the library automation service system market faces several challenges and restraints. High initial investment costs for implementing sophisticated ILS can pose a barrier for smaller libraries and institutions with limited budgets. The complexity of integrating different systems and databases can also create difficulties, requiring specialized technical expertise and significant time investments. Data security and privacy concerns are paramount, particularly with the increasing reliance on cloud-based solutions. Ensuring data integrity and protecting sensitive user information requires robust security measures and compliance with relevant regulations. The need for continuous training and support for library staff to effectively utilize the new systems is also a significant challenge. Keeping pace with technological advancements requires ongoing investments in training and professional development. Furthermore, resistance to change within some libraries, coupled with a lack of awareness of the benefits of automation, can hinder adoption. Overcoming these challenges requires a multifaceted approach, involving collaborative efforts between vendors, libraries, and technology experts to create affordable, user-friendly, and secure solutions.
The Commercial System segment is poised to dominate the library automation service system market over the forecast period. Commercial systems offer a range of features and functionalities unavailable in open-source alternatives, including robust support, regular updates, and advanced features such as integrated discovery layers and sophisticated analytics dashboards. This segment is further subdivided based on application type, with Public Libraries representing a significant portion of the market.
High Adoption Rate in Developed Regions: North America and Western Europe are expected to maintain their leading positions in terms of market share. These regions have a higher concentration of well-funded libraries and a greater awareness of the benefits of automation. The maturity of the library sector in these regions translates to increased willingness to invest in sophisticated systems and a higher level of technological literacy among staff.
Growth in Emerging Markets: While currently lagging behind, emerging markets in Asia-Pacific, particularly countries experiencing rapid economic growth and urbanization, present significant untapped potential. As these economies develop and libraries seek to improve their services, the demand for commercial automation systems is projected to surge. The expansion of digital literacy and government initiatives to support library modernization in these regions further contribute to this growth.
Competitive Landscape within Commercial Systems: The commercial system segment is characterized by a range of established vendors offering diverse solutions. The presence of both large multinational corporations and specialized providers fosters healthy competition, driving innovation and keeping prices competitive.
Advantages of Commercial Systems: The comprehensive features offered by commercial systems, including integrated modules for cataloging, circulation, acquisitions, and digital asset management, are a key factor contributing to their dominance. The level of technical support provided by commercial vendors is also significantly superior to open-source alternatives, ensuring smooth operation and minimal downtime. Regular updates and feature enhancements keep the systems relevant and competitive. The seamless integration of these systems with other library management tools is another considerable advantage.
